The Turkish defense technological and industrial base has reached a critical mass across certain segments. The successful trajectory of the unfolding projects manifests a new reality in the realm of air power. While the Bayraktar TB-2, aka the “flying Kalashnikov” by Baykar, has made most of the headlines, the Turkish drone program is not merely about that. Turkey has built a reputable edge in designing wide range of high-value assets.

In the drone warfare segment, Baykar’s unmanned combat aircraft Kizilelma and the company’s high-altitude drone equipped with high-end weapons, Akinci, as well as Turkish Aerospace Industries’ flying wing, stealthy unmanned combat aircraft Anka-3 loom large as some examples. Even more importantly, the Anka-3 and Kizilelma are designed to fly within the loyal wingman concept alongside manned aircraft, which is technically a sixth-generation tactical military aviation feature, presaging the future horizons of Turkish defense planning. 

In the manned fighter jet segment, Kaan, formerly known as the Milli Muharip Uçak, presents interesting takeaways to grasp the Turkish defense industry’s international dynamics. In February 2024, Turkey’s indigenous, stealth combat aircraft, Kaan, conducted its maiden flight. Besides painting a shiny picture of the future of Turkish air power, Kaan also sheds light on some of the ongoing capability limitations of the nation’s defense technological and industrial base (DTIB). The first problem pertains to the jet’s power configuration. The initial batches, and the prototype of the aircraft, fly with the F-110 engines that power the F-16 fighter jet, illustrating a clear dependency. 

With the rising trajectory and still-in-place limitations of the Turkish DTIB’s air power generation capacity, one has to answer two political-military questions pertaining to the nature of defense business: First, what kind of an arms exporter is Turkey to become considering its aerial assets? Will it follow a more reserved model, such as Germany? Or a more business-friendly one like France? Or, will it pursue more of a market disrupter role like China? Second, how will the nation’s foreign collaboration network take shape?

Turkey’s defense cooperation outlook

From a geopolitical standpoint, Turkey’s success in unmanned aerial technologies has positioned it as a burgeoning drone-exporting nation within the transatlantic Alliance. 

Indeed, Turkey’s drone warfare success, at least in the headlines, started with the Bayraktar TB-2’s combat record in Syria and Libya. Still, to grasp the Turkish drone warfare’s defense diplomacy dimension, one has to know more about other operators of the drone.

Both in the second Nagorno-Karabakh War and the ongoing Russian full-scale invasion of Ukraine, the Turkish Bayraktar TB-2 has helped the operating countries, Azerbaijan and Ukraine, in the hard turning points of their respective quests. Having proven its combat performance, the TB-2 paved the way for a fruitful strategic collaboration with these nations. A series of cooperative production deals between the Turkish drone manufacturer Baykar, and Ukraine and Azerbaijan, respectively, stand out as important examples of such defense industry collaborations. More importantly, having capitalized on the TB-2’s combat performance, Baykar established defense companies in Kyiv and Baku. But these are not one-way journeys. The engine collaboration for the Kizilelma drone with Kyiv, for example, has opened a new chapter in Ukrainian-Turkish military ties. At present, Ukraine also eyes engine deals for Turkey’s manned combat aircraft segment. 

In the manned aircraft segment, a careful assessment of Kaan’s export portfolio would explain Turkey’s defense diplomacy outlook for its advanced solutions. To keep the unit costs at manageable levels, Turkey needs to find lucrative deals to market the aircraft. Yet Kaan will enter an international market characterized by fierce competition. Therefore, transforming the Kaan into an attractive platform for clients seeking either enhanced fourth- or the more advanced fifth-generation fighter jets will be a critical priority, especially at a time when the F-35 dominates the Euro-Atlantic market and when other alternatives, such as the Rafale by Dassault Aviation of France and soon the South Korean KF-21 Boramae by Korea Aerospace Industries, are seeking to capture the remainder of the pie globally. SAAB’s  Gripen, on the other hand, is losing its market share. All in all, Paris and Seoul are aiming to increase their market share in critical arms industries, indicating that Turkey will also face heavy competition.  The Kaan could function as a geopolitical ledger that opens the path for new international partnerships. The combat aircraft will likely offer an effective solution to countries that cannot procure F-35s such as Pakistan or the Gulf Arab nations, due to a series of sensitive political impediments; though the latter may impinge on Seoul’s interest in selling its new Boramae. Another natural target for Turkey’s multirole combat solution would be militaries that want to replace their Soviet era-remnant arsenals with a defense ecosystem that is in line with NATO standards, such as the non-NATO former Soviet space, which has traditionally been Russia’s markets. In this regard, Azerbaijan and Ukraine loom large as two particularly interesting potential operator nations as Kaan’s export market slowly takes shape in the coming years.

The geopolitical showdown ahead

From a defense economics standpoint, Turkey’s serious air power projects, such as high-end drones and advanced manned aircraft, will also help the West to counterbalance its great power competitors in the international arms market. According to the Stockholm International Peace Research Institute, Moscow and Beijing constituted around 16 percent and 5.2 percent of the global arms exports between 2018 and 2022, respectively, although the former’s share decreased following its stumbling invasion in Ukraine. Yet China continues to pose a real risk to the NATO members’ overall weapons market presence in several regions.  

China has already snatched up the Middle Eastern drone market amid a long absence of American solutions due to restrictions. Turkey’s drone sales to the Gulf, and recently Egypt, offered a critical comeback to tackle the Chinese share in the unmanned aerial systems segment. In the coming years, China’s potential presence in the Middle Eastern manned aircraft market will be among the highest priorities to track. The Kaan can offer some help in this respect.  

Therefore, it is important to note that, unlike popular speculations in the Turkish press, the Kaan will not compete with the F-35 head-on. Instead, it will introduce an alternative, NATO-grade solution in the manned aircraft segment that can be delivered to the nations that cannot purchase the F-35. While it will directly compete with the combat aircraft of Russia and China, both Korea and France will join the contest. The million-dollar question, for now, is about who will dominate the Gulf manned aircraft market in the absence of F-35. 

Extending technology transfers in the drone warfare realm

Along with market opportunities, Turkey’s limits in arms transfers and coproduction deals remain key to understanding how the nation’s defense business will play out in the near term.

The Akinci is an interesting example, as it illustrates how the Turkish DTIB is evolving around high-end platforms. Akinci’s weapon systems configuration, featuring Turkey’s first aeroballistic missile, TRG-230-İHA, and a stand-off missile (SOM) baseline of cruise missiles, transforms the platform into a deep strike asset. The high-altitude long endurance (HALE) drone can also fly up to 40,000 feet (out of the engagement envelope of short-to-medium air defense systems). Looming large as one of the most capable platforms in the Turkish export portfolio, Akinci has started to leave a footprint in the international weapons market. In the summer of 2023, Baykar signed a historic export and coproduction deal with the state-owned Saudi Arabian Military Industries for local production and technology transfer. Roketsan and Aselsan, the primary manufacturers of the platform’s critical weapon systems configuration and sensors, were also included in the deals. 

Baykar’s deal with the United Arab Emirates’ Edge Group to arm the Bayraktar TB-2 with Emirati payloads in early 2024 is another notable example. The procurement package marked the first instance of a Turkish drone maker certifying foreign munitions to be integrated into its platforms. 

Last, having monitored the Ukrainian military’s successful TB-2 employment at the outset of the conflict, the TB-2 is also expanding its footprint in NATO markets. Following Poland, Romania has purchased the drone in a lucrative deal.

During the Cold War, Turkey—a NATO nation standing up to more than twenty Soviet Red Army divisions—remained a decades-long net arms importer. Thus, perhaps the country’s transformation into a key arms exporter, especially in advanced technologies such as drone warfare assets, has marked one of the most important developments in the Euro-Atlantic security affairs in the twenty-first century.

The Turkish model comes with successes and limitations. Turkey’s shipyards are now capable of designing principal surface combatants, frigates, and corvettes. In the submarine segment, however, especially in air-independent propulsion systems, Turkey’s needs foreign collaboration. Likewise, the Turkish defense industry can produce most of the land warfare solutions, albeit, the national tank program, Altay, still awaits its entry into the army’s arsenal. The aerial systems segment in not a different one compared to the naval and land warfare segments. In the air, the Turkish aerial drone design and production prowess is one of the best in the international weapons market. The manned aircraft segment, nonetheless, is lagging behind. As to high-end systems, manned or unmanned, engine configuration will continue to be troublesome for years to come.  Turkey’s calculus goes well beyond merely becoming an off-the-shelf arms supplier. Ankara aims to establish deep-rooted ties in the market nations while paving the way to bring those nations’ capabilities to Turkey’s DTIB when possible, as is the case with the Ukrainian industries. Drones are still pioneering the Turkish defense outreach in the air. The path of Kaan, as well as the unmanned combat aircraft/loyal wingman projects, Kizilelma and Anka-3, will determine the final trajectory of the nation’s defense business outlook in the air.
